
'Landslide' is a song by the British-American rock band Fleetwood Mac, written and performed by Stevie Nicks in 1975. While working as a waitress and cleaning lady to financially support herself and Lindsey Buckingham, Nicks revealed that she was contemplating whether to go back to school or continue her career with guitarist Lindsey Buckingham when she wrote this song. After the release of their debut album 'Buckingham Nicks', they were dropped by Polydor Records before they could release a follow-up. Nicks composed the song while visiting Aspen, Colorado, "looking out at the Rocky Mountains and thinking about everything crashing down." She recalled that her life truly felt like a 'landslide' at that moment.
